FTS Report on DOY 237 I. The following are clock offsets, in microseconds between the clocks at each DSN complex and each complex relative to UTC(USNO). The offset is a mean of readings using several GPS space vehicles in common view. Comments: NOTES: All DSN data are from the new multichannel receivers. SPC 10 and SPC 60 offsets are commonviewed with USNO and with each other.
